foto de Bertilo Name: Bertilo WENNERGREN (bertilow)

Country: South Korea and Germany (with a Swedish passport)

Responsibilities: Programming and language advice

Introduction: I was born in 1956. I learned Esperanto in 1980 (after being interested in the language for many years). I am a programmer and musician, and a member of the Academy of Esperanto. I live together with my wife mostly in Seoul, South Korea, but for part of the year in Germany. Esperanto is our home language.



foto de Erinja Name: Erin PIATESKI (erinja)

Country: United States

Responsibilities: Translates the lernu! website into English, helps with sound recording, and organises collaboration between lernu! and NASK.

Introduction: I was born in 1980, near the capital city of the United States. I started learning Esperanto in 1995 because I heard that Esperanto was an easy language, and I wanted to be able to fluently speak a foreign language. I didn't imagine at all at the time that you could travel using Esperanto. I am a mechanical engineer. In my free time I like to read and to cook vegetarian food from around the world.


foto de Hokan Name: Hokan LUNDBERG (ho)

Country: Sweden

Responsibilities: In lernu! helps with programming, courses, and planning.

Introduction: I was born in Sweden in 1972 and started with Esperanto as a 25-year old. Since then, I have been active in various Esperanto projects and organizations. In 2002 I went to live in Belgrade (Serbia) with Sonja Petrovic (another team member) and worked full-time on Esperanto projects, mostly lernu.net, for 3 years. Now I live in Stockholm (Sweden) and I teach programming at a high school.



foto de Jevgenij Name: Jevgenij GAUS (Jev)

Country: Lithuania

Responsibilities: Is now the primary programmer of lernu!.

Introduction: I started my life in the year 1978. In 1999 I started to learn Esperanto and after several months of learning, started to teach it. Now I study law and at the same time, I am involved in Esperanto. I really like to keep busy with various international projects.




foto de Neringa Name: Neringa GAUS (Jasminka)

Country: Lithuania

Responsibilities: Works on lernu! content, creates exercises, works on the sections "Periodicals" and "Word of the day", helps with translation of lernu!.

Introduction: In the year 1984, destiny decided that I should begin to see the world, and I ... was born. I began to learn Esperanto in 2001 and little by little became busy with various E-projects. Now I dedicate much time to lernu! and to the Lithuanian language internet magazine "Esperanto mozaika". Aside from that I study computer science at a Lithuanian university.



foto de Sonja Name: Sonja PETROVIĆ (so)

Country: Serbia and Montenegro (but now lives in Sweden)

Responsibilities: Official coordinator of lernu! projects, is occupied with a bit of nearly everything ;-).

Introduction: In the year 1998, as a 15-year old, I decided to learn Esperanto to experience countries other than the ex-Yugoslavia, where I was born. In retrospect, it was a good idea: thanks to Esperanto, I have done a lot of international travel, until 2004, when my daughter Iva was born. In 2005 we moved to Sweden, the home country of Iva's father, Hokan.
Aside from Esperanto projects and playing with the little one, I study and I enjoy reading, meeting friends, growing flowers and vegetables, and decorating our new home.


Important team members


Aaron CHAPMAN (Arono)

Provides voice and recording and was the chief visual designer of lernu!. He lives with his wife Charlene in Vancouver, Canada. Aaron is one of the first team members.

Allon ROTHFARB (Allon)

A programmer from Israel. Helped with programming and making the Hebrew version (and other languages written right to left - RTL) of the site functional.

Chuck SMITH (amuzulo)

The founder of the Wikipedia in Esperanto and Eklaboru. He helped translate and test lernu!.

Clayton SMITH (Argilo)

The first head programmer of the site. He is now occupied with server administration at lernu!

Cleve LENDON

Programmer from Canada who now lives in Tokyo, Japan. In lernu! he created the word separator for the dictionary and several games. As well as creating software and Esperanto homepages, Cleve enjoys Irish dancing.

Helen CLAESSON

Drew most of the illustrations on the site, including pictures for the courses "Gerda Malaperis", "Jen nia IJK", "Ana Pana", and "Ana Renkontas", pictures in the concise grammar, and all pictures with Maz the cat.

Henning VON ROSEN (henning)

Contributed much to the concept of lernu!, was one of the first team members. Helped create a picture dictionary for lernu!. Henning lives in Sweden.

Ingvar VON SCHOULTZ (Ingvar)

He lives in Sweden. He helped lernu! with programming, primarily for the course "Vojaĝu kun Zam".

Oleg IZYUMENKO (Oleg326756)

Helped lernu! with translation into Russian, language tutoring, and implementation of Google technologies at the site. Also worked to obtain support from Google for lernu! and implement lernu!'s participation in Google's programs.

Radojica PETROVIC

Created exercises for the lernu! course "Jen nia IJK". Teaches computer science and teaching methods at a university in Ĉaĉak, Serbia and Montenegro. Radojica is the president of ILEI (the International League of Esperanto Teachers). Does a lot of work for project Interkulturo.

Vitaly MONASTYREV (mesh)

A programmer from the Ukraine, now living in Germany. Helped with programming and the downloadable version of lernu!.
